By every metric Idaho Falls should be the better town - but...
By every metric Idaho Falls should be the better town - but I'd take Pocatello over it any day of the week. I don't like the layout at all.
The only thing IF has better is their mall and mom & pop food options.
If you're going to have fun, their bars quit serving an hour earlier than Pocatello - and Pocatello bars are 10xs better.

The fall’s themselves and the story about how the...
The fall’s themselves and the story about how the electricity for the area has evolved were quite interesting. The Museum of Idaho , while overpriced, had a lot of interesting information about Idaho.
